Ingredients
Scale
- 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s or bre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
- 2 tablespoons lime juice (from about 1 large lime)
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on ground turmeric
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ium yellow onion, finely ch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on grated fresh ginger
- 1 (13.5 oz) can full-fat coconut milk
- 1/2 cup chicken broth (low sodium)
- 2 tablespoons fish sauce (optional, for authentic flavor)
- 1 tablespoon brown sugar (or honey/maple syrup)
- Zest of 1 lime
- Juice of 1 large lime (about 2 tablespoons)
- F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)
- Lime wedges (for garnish)
- Red pepper flakes (for a touch of heat, optional)
Instructions
- Marinate the Chicken: In a medium bowl, combine the cut chicken pieces with 2 tablespoons lime juice, 1 tablespoon olive oil, turmeric, salt, and black pepper. Toss everything together until the chicken is evenly coated. Cover and let marinate at room temperature for 15-20 minutes (or up to 2 hours in the refrigerator).
- Brown the Chicken: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add the marinated chicken in a single layer (in batches if necessary) and sear for 3-4 minutes per side until golden brown. Remove chicken and set aside.
- Build the Flavorful Sauce: Reduce heat to medium. Add chopped onion to the same skillet and sauté for 3-5 minutes until soft. Stir in min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for 1 minute until fragrant.
- Simmer the Dish: Pour in coconut milk, chicken broth, fish sauce (if using), and brown sugar. Bring to a gentle simmer, stirring well. Return browned chicken to the skillet, cover, and simmer on low heat for 15-20 minutes, or until ch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Finish and Serve: Remove from heat. Stir in fresh lime zest and the remaining 2 tablespoons of lime juice. Taste and adjust seasonings. Garnish generously with fresh chopped cilantro and serve immediately with extra lime wedges.
Notes
- For best flavor, use fresh lime juice and zest; avoid bottled lime juice.
- Don’t overcrowd the pan when browning chicken to ensure a good sear.
- If the sauce is too thin, remove the chicken and simmer uncovered for a few extra minutes to reduce.
- Leftovers store well in the refrigerator for 3-4 days and can be frozen for up to 2-3 months.
